About this Private Foundation: 370116


Located in DALLAS, TX, this notable foundation holds assets exceeding $722.5k. According to its latest 990-PF filing, it distributed $31.3k in grants, offering a median grant amount of $26k. The largest single grant issued was $26k. Its funding primarily supports organizations engaged in Philanthropy, with additional interests in areas like Voluntarism & Grantmaking Foundations and more. Although headquartered in DALLAS, TX, the foundation's reach may extend to nonprofits across the U.S. and Canada. The Grant Portal is aimed at giving nonprofits unfettered access to a public dataset of Form 990 tax filings published by the IRS.

The project republishes the IRS dataset, verbatim, focusing exclusively on Form 990 PF, the form most commonly filed by private foundations.

Note that the IRS dataset only contains information from electronically-filed tax returns.

The Grant Portal is not affiliated, associated, authorized, endorsed by, or in any way officially connected with any foundation appearing on the site.
